2Terms

2.0.1Micro-assembling

Thetechnologyofformingadvancedmicroelectronicmoduleisassemblyofvariousmicroparts

andcomponents,integratedcircuitchipsandchipcomponentswhichconsistofelectroniccircuitsonthe

highdensitymultilayerinterconnectedsubstratebysurfacemountingandinterconnectionprocess.

2.0.2Multilayersubstrate

Substratewithembeddedconductorlayersforimplementingcomplexinterconnectioncircuits.

2.0.3Thickfilm

Filmwhichisdepositedonthesubstratebyscreenprintingprocessandsinteredatthehighest

temperatureofabout850℃.

2.0.4Lowtemperatureco-firedceramic(LTCC)multilayersubstrate

Aftermultipleunsinteredflexiblegreentapes,ofwhichthickfilmconductorsandresistancefigures

(includinginterconnectedlinesthatconsistofthesefigures,embeddedpassivecomponent,etc.)are

printedonthesurface,andwhichinterlaminarinterconnectedmetallized专用holesaremanufactured,are

stackedinorder,laminatingthemintoawholestructurebyheatingandpressingsimultaneously.By

sinteringthegreentapesandthickfilmelectronicpasteatamaximumtemperatureofabout850℃

(sinteringfurnace)rigidandhighdensitymultilayerinterconnectedsubstratesareformedfinally.

2.0.5Thinfilmmultilayersubstrate

Multilayerinterconnectedsubstratewhichoverlappedandinterconnectedmultilayerthinfilm

conductorandinterlaminarinsulatingfilmaremanufacturedoninsulatingsubstrateorsiliconwaferwith

filmformingprocessesofvacuumevaporation,sputtering,chemicalvapordepositionetc.and

technologyofphotoetching,etchingetc.

2.0.6Greentape

Atape-likeflexiblethinceramicmaterialwithsmoothsurface,uniformtextureandcertainstrength

whichismanufacturedbycastingprocess.

2.0.7Packaging

Microelectronictechnologyofinterconnection,protectionandheatdissipationforelectronicdevices

(microcircuitsormodule),whichmainlyincludeplasticpackaging,ceramicpackagingandmetal

packaging.人人文库

2.0.8Processinspection

Theprocessofmeasuringandinspectingtheproducts'shape,size,positionanditsmechanical,

physical,chemicalcharacteristicsandsoonbytools,instrumentsorequipmentofmeasuringortesting,

andcomparingwiththetechnologyrequirementsofproducts.Itistheinspectiontechniquetoevaluate

theconformityofprocedureorstateofproductcompletionwiththeruleofdesignandprocedure

documents.

3Basicrequirements

3.1Constructionconditions

3.1.1Thecleanroomshallbeinaccordancewiththefollowingrequirementsbeforeinstallationofthe

micro-assemblingequipment:

1Acceptanceofemptyroomshallbequalifiedandtheairconditioningsystemshalloperate

continuouslyandnormallyformorethan24h.

2Temperatureshouldbe20℃to26℃.

3Relativehumidityshouldbe30%to70%.

4Load-bearingcapabilityoffloorshallmeetrequirementsofequipment.

5Clearanceheightshallmeetinstallationrequirementsofequipment.

6Bodypurificationfacilityattheroomentranceshallhavebeeninoperation.

7Theequipmententryshallbeavailable.

8Firefightingfacilitiesshallhavebeenpassedspecialacceptanceandcanbeenabled.

9Theantistaticfacilitiesintheantistaticworkingareashallhavepassed专用thetestandacceptance.

10Powersupply,gassource,watersourceandgroundingterminalshallbeavailableandin

accordancewithrequirements.

11Employeesafeevacuationchannelsshallbesetup.

3.1.2Theinstallationofmicro-assemblingequipmentshallhavethefollowingtechnicaldocuments:

1Equipmentinstallationplan.

2Equipmentpackinglist.

3Technicaldocumentsforinstallation,operation,maintenanceandinstallationtechnicalparameters

ofequipmentprovidedbyequipmentmanufacturers.

3.1.3Theconstructionpersonnelshallenterthepurificationroomwithapassportofenteringtheclean

area.Specialtypesofworkersshallbecertificatedinaccordancewithrelevantprovisions.

3.1.4Equipmentinstallationandhook-upengineeringmaterialsshallmeettherelevantrequirements

ofcurrentnationalstandardGB50472CodeforDesignofElectronicIndustryCleanRoom.

3.1.5Equipmentandtoolsusedinconstructionshallmeettherelevantrequirementsofcurrent

nationalstandardGB50467CodeforConstructionandAcceptanceofMicro-electronicsManufacturing

EquipmentInstallation人人文库Engineering.

3.2Equipmentunpacking

3.2.1Equipmentshallbeunpackedwithjointparticipationofresponsiblepersonnelofsupplyunit,

constructionunitanddevelopmentunit.Unpackingofimportedequipmentforstatutorycommodity

inspectionshallbeattendedbycustomsinspectionrepresentatives.

3.2.2Packingcaseshallbecheckedfordamageanddamagedegreebeforeequipmentunpacking,anti-

vibrationandanti-tiltmarksshallnotbeabnormal.

3.2.3Equipmentunpackingshallbeinaccordancewiththefollowingrequirements:

1Packingcaseshallbeunpackedbyeffectivetoolsandfollowingreasonableproceduresunder

thepremiseofcausingnodamagetotheequipmentanditsaccessoriesinthecase.

2Thetopcoverofthecaseshallberemovedfirstafterremovingroofnailsorrelevantfasteners.

3Afterremovingthetopcoverandpart(orall)sidecoversofthecase,smallpartsandaccessories

shallberemovedfromthecasepriortomainframe,andthencarryouttheremainingworkofunpacking.

3.2.4Afterequipmentunpacking,packingmaterialshallberemovedintime.

3.2.5Afterequipmentunpacking,intactnessofinternalequipment,packageandaccessoriesshallbe

checked,anyabnormalsituationshallhaveimagerecordimmediatelyandputforwardtheprocessing

advice.

3.2.6Afterequipmentunpacking,equipmentshallbecheckedinaccordancewiththefollowing

requirements:

1Typespecificationontheequipmentnameplateshallbeconsistentwithequipmentlistor

technicalparameterlist.

2Iftheexteriorandprotectivepackageofequipmenthavedefects,damageorrustiness,itshallbe

putforwardandrecordedintime.Formanufacturingdefects,notifytheequipmentmanufacturerto

researchthehandlingmethod.

3Checkwhethertheparts,components,tools,accessories,subsidiarymaterials,andother

technicaldocumentsarecompleteonebyoneaccordingtothepackinglist,andshallmakearecord.

4Afterunpackingandinspectingtheequipment,theparts,accessories专用,accessorymaterials,tools

andfixtures,andtechnicaldocumentsthatneednottoinstallorbeusedforinstallationshallbeputinto

thecustodyoftheuser.

3.2.7Inspectionrecordsshallbefilledinwhenunpackingequipment,thecontentandformatshallbe

inaccordancewiththosespecifiedinTableA.0.1ofthiscode.

3.3Equipmentmoving

3.3.1Equipmentmovinginmethodofliftingshallbeinaccordancewiththefollowingrequirements:

1Steelcableusedinliftingshallbeabletowithstandover10tofweight.

2Craneoperatorsshallbecertificated.

3Cablebindingpositionshallavoidinstrumentandfragilestructure.Theequipmentcenterof

gravityshallbepaidattentionwhenlifting,andpreventtheequipmentfromdumpingandfalling.

4Theliftingheightofequipmentshouldbesuitableforremovingtheouterbottompackaging.

5Liftingandloweringspeedshallbecontrolledwhenoperating,noimpactorcollisionshall

occur.

3.3.2Themechanical人人文库facilitiesofforkliftsoraircushionsetc.shallbeusedwhenpositioninglarge-

scalemicro-assemblinglineproductionprocessequipmentintheroom.

3.3.3Thelengthoftwoforksshallexceed100mmofgravitycenterofequipmentwhenforkliftisused.

3.3.4Operationshallbesteadywhenmovingequipmentwithahydraulicloader.

3.3.5Movingequipmentwithaircushionshallbeinaccordancewiththefollowingrequirements:

1Aircushionsshallbeplacedundertheloadbeamatthebottomofequipment,andthenumberof

aircushionsforeachequipmentshallnotbelessthan4.

2Aircushionsshalltravelsteadilyafterinflating.Theheightofequipmentbottomfromthe

groundshallnotbelessthan2mm.

3.3.6Theprotectivemeasuresforthefloorshallbetakenwhenequipmentismovedintheroom.

3.4Equipmentinstallation

3.4.1Installationofmicro-assemblingequipmentshallbeinaccordancewiththefollowing

requirements:

1Full-openspaceofelectricboxandspaceofoperationandmaintenanceshallbereservedwhen

positioningtheequipment.

2Theprimarypipeandlinedistributionofpowersupply,gassource,watersourceandground

terminalsshallhavebeeninplace.

3Surfaceofequipmentshallbeprotectedduringinstallation.Sealingsurfaceshallnotbe

damagedorscratched.Installationofequipmentshallbefirmandreliable.Sunkscrewshallnotprotrude

overthesurfaceofconnectedparts.

4Whentheequipmenthasrequirementsofanti-vibrationcontrolorparticularload-bearing,

correspondingmeasuresofanti-vibrationorimprovementofload-bearingcapabilityshallbetaken.

5Hook-upofequipmentshallbecompletedbyprofessionalsinaccordancewithtechnical

requirementsofequipment.TheSS316Lstainlesssteelpipeshouldbeusedforthevacuumpipelineof

accessequipment.Pipingofpurewater,compressedair,etc.shouldbeconnectedwithequipmentby

PTFEandpolyurethanehoses.

3.4.2Directinstallationofmicro-assemblingequipmentonthefloorshall专用beinaccordancewiththe

followingrequirements:

1Basegasketshallbeplacedonthegroundfirst,andconfirmedthatbasicgasketcanevenly

supporttheequipment.

2Handshallnotbeplacedabovethebasegasketduringoperation.

3Ifequipmentisequippedwithbottombolts,eachbottomboltshallbeproperlyinstalledinits

screwhole.Aircushionsshallbeusedtomovetheequipment.

4Theequipmentshallbeleveledgraduallybyadjustingtheheightofanchorboltsortheeffective

thicknessofbasegasket,andensurethatthelocknutisgaplessandeachbottomboltisfixedtothe

correspondingbasegasketonthefloor.

3.4.3Directinstallationofmicro-assemblingequipmentontheplatformshallbeinaccordancewith

thefollowingrequirements:

1Operatingplatformshallbehorizontal,steadyandfirm.

2Antistaticmaterialshallbelaidontheplatformandeffectivelyconnectedtoantistatic

groundingsystemofroom.

3.4.4Horizontal人人文库adjustmentofequipmentshouldusethecross-testleveltomeasure,andthe

equipmentwithhighprecisionrequirementsmayusetwobracket-typelevels.

3.4.5Groundingofmicro-assemblingequipmentshallbeeffectiveandreliable,andgroundingterminal

shallbefirmlyconnectedtogroundingsystemofcleanroom.Groundingresistanceofequipmentshall

notexceed4Ω;Groundingsystemshallmeettherelevantrequirementsofcurrentnationalstandard

GB50169CodeforConstructionandAcceptanceofGroundingConnectionElectricEquipment

InstallationEngineering.

3.4.6Aftertheequipmentisinplace,powerconfigurationofequipmentshallbecheckedbytechnicians.

3.4.7Recordofinstallationprojectshallbefilledinaftertheequipmentisinstalled,contentandformat

shallbeinaccordancewiththosespecifiedinTableA.0.2ofthiscode.

3.5Debuggingandcommissioningofequipment

3.5.1Debuggingandcommissioningofmicro-assemblingequipmentshallbeinaccordancewiththe

followingrequirements:

1Theequipmenthasbeeninstalledinplace.

2Allkindsofpowerhook-upsshallensurethattheconnectiontotheequipmentissealedand

firm,thevariousparametersofthepowershallmeettherequirementsoftheequipment.

3Compressedairandprocessgasshallbecleanedbeforepumpingintotheequipment.

3.5.2Wiringofmicro-assemblingequipmentshallbecheckedbeforeoperating.

3.5.3Safetyofmicro-assemblingequipmentshallbetestedtomeetrequirementsbeforeoperation.

3.5.4Inthebootstate,aclampammetershallbeusedtomeasurewhetherthevoltageandcurrent

meettherequirementsofequipment.

3.5.5Inthebootstate,theequivalentcontinuousAweightedsoundlevelatpersonneloperating

positionshouldnotbegreaterthan70dB.

3.5.6Equipmentshallcontinuouslyoperatewithoutfailurefor48h.Beforeandafterthecontinuous

operation,themainperformanceindicatorsofequipmentshallbetested.Theresultsshallmeetthe

technicalrequirementsofequipment.

3.5.7Thedebuggingandcommissioningrecordsofmicro-assembling专用equipmentshallbefilledinfor

thesinglecommissioningwhichiscompliedwiththerelevantprovisionsofChapters4to7ofthiscode.

ThecontentandformatoftherecordsshallbeinaccordancewiththosespecifiedinTableA.0.3.

4Installation,debuggingandcommissioningoflowtemperatureco-fined

ceramicandthickfilmsubstrateproductionprocessequipment

4.1Generalrequirements

4.1.1Lowtemperatureco-finedceramic(LTCC)andthickfilmequipmentshallmainlyincludethe

tapecaster,blanker,greentapepuncher,laserscribingmachine,viafillingmachine,screenprinter,

stackingmachine,isostaticpresslaminator,hotcutter,LTCCsinteringfurnace,thick-filmsintering

furnaceandlaserresistortrimmer.Allofthemmaybedirectlyinstalledontheground.

4.1.2LTCCsubstratemanufacturingprocessequipmentshallmeettherequirementsoflinkage,and

relevantperformanceindexofkeyLTCCprocessequipmentshallbeverifiedbytestingproductionand

performanceindicatorsofLTCCstandardtest-versionproducts.

4.1.3CleanlinessofroomusedforinstallationofLTCCandthickfilmequipmentshallbeatleast7

Level,thetemperatureofcleanroomshouldbe18℃to25℃,andtherelativehumidityshouldbe40%to

60%.

4.2Tapecaster专用

4.2.1Theinstallationofthetapecastershallbeinaccordancewiththefollowingrequirements:

1Castcarrierplateshallbegraduallylevelledbyadjustinganchorbolts.

2Thedirectionofwhichthedrycastwindsuppliedtotheexhaustwindshallbeoppositetothat

ofthecasttape.

3Theelectriccontrolcabinetshallbeinstalledatthepositionofmorethan1meterawayfrom

themaincastingcavity,andthemetalcabinetshallbedense.

4Openflameorotherdangeroussourcesofelectricalsparksmustnotappeararound

castingcavity.

5InstallationofPETfilmcarriertapeshallensurethatconveyissteadywithoutdeviatingandthe

tapeworkssmoothlywithoutarching.

4.2.2Thedebuggingandcommissioningofthetapecastershallbeinaccordancewiththefollowing

requirements:

1Theporcelainslurrytobecastthathasbeenballmilledmixtureandvacuumdefoamingshallbe

prepared.人人文库

2Gasleakagealarmandsafetyprotectiondeviceofequipmentshallworknormally,doorof

castingcavityshallbereliablylocked.

3Mainparametersofspeedandtensionofconveyerbelt,temperatureofeachtemperaturezone

ofcastingcavity,speedofwindsuppliedandexhausted,andtheheightofcastingscraperetc.shallbeset

reasonably.

4Carriertapeshallconveywithconstantspeedandwindingfreely,andthesurfaceshallbe

smoothwithoutprotrusions.

5Castershallworksteadilywithoutshaking.

6Whensupplyingporcelainslurrytotroughoftapecastertoscrapandcast,castershallsupply

thereverseexhaustwind,thecastingcavityshallbesealedwell,andtheoperatorsinthecastingroom

shallnotsmellthepeculiarodorofsolventfromcastingcavitywhiledryingporcelainslurry.

7Whentheperformanceandqualityofporcelainslurryarequalifiedandcastingparametersare

setreasonably,greentapeproducedbycastershallbedryandflat.Thethicknessofthegreentapeinthe

left,middleandrightlateralpositionsshallbemeasuredwithmicrometerandallowabledeviationof

thicknessuniformityshallbe±5%.

4.3Blanker

4.3.1Installationofblankershallbeinaccordancewiththefollowingrequirements:

1Forblankerthatcanbecompatiblewithgreentapesofdifferentwidth,componentsofblanker

shallbereplacedandpresetbyprofessionalsaccordingtodifferentrequirements.

2Foursuctioncupsofmanipulatorshallbeadjustedonthesamehorizontalplane.

4.3.2Debuggingandcommissioningofblankershallbeinaccordancewiththefollowing

requirements:

1Aftertheinitializationofeachkinematicshaft,thegreentaperollshallbeinstalledontheair

expansionshaftandinflatetofixit.Greentapeshallbetowthroughthetoolbithorizontallyandneatly.

2Conveyrollersshallbeproperlyadjustedtoavoiddeviationswhenfeedingtape.

3Blankershallbeabletoaccuratelyandeffectivelyblankwhenmultilayer专用thingreentapesstack

to1mmgreentapewithpolymerfilm.

4Underthepremisethatblankingisqualifiedandparametersissetreasonably,thecutofgreen

tapeshallbeclean,tidy,sharp,andfreeofmicro-crackunderthemicroscopeof30timesmagnification.

Allowabledeviationofthesizeforgreentapeshallbe±0.5mm.

4.4Greentapepuncher

4.4.1Installationofgreentapepunchershallbeinaccordancewiththefollowingrequirements:

1Withoutdoorinoperationarea,punchershallbeequippedwithprotectivelightcurtainand

enabled.

2Forgreentapepuncherthatcanbecompatiblewithdifferentlengthandwidth,thecomponents

shallbereplacedandpresetbyprofessionalsaccordingtodifferentrequirements.

4.4.2Debuggingandcommissioningofthegreentapepunchershallbeinaccordancewiththe

followingrequirements:

1Pretreatmentofgreentapeshallbecompletedaccordingtobakingcondition.

2Greentape人人文库thatneedtobeontheframeshallbeflattenedwithnegativepressureontheporous

stonefirstly,andthenadhesivetapeisusedtostickgreentapetotheframe.Adhesivetapeshallbeflat

andframeshallbewithoutwarping.

3Mainprocessparameterssuchaswaitingtimeofpunch,waitingtimeofXYmanipulatorafter

suckingmaterialandpunchspeedshallbeset.

4XYmanipulatorshallmovesteadilywhenresettingpuncher,andtheupanddownmodulesof

punchercomponentsshallpunchfreely.

5Specialmoduleadjustmenttoolshallbeusedtoadjustthepositionofupperandlowermodules

tomakethemcoaxial.Thepositionofpunchingpinshallbere-calibratedafterreplacingthepunching

pin.

6Punchershalloperatesteadilywithoutshaking.

7Palletofgreentapeshallbekepthorizontallywithoutwarpingetc.Greentapeshallbelocated

inthecenterofvacuumchuckafterbesuckedup.Attachmentlengthofgreentapewithfoursidesof

vacuumchuckshallbethesame,andsuctionshallbeintightwithoutgaps.
